-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
Typically, we would set up a meeting (either in person, via Skype, or via phone call/ text). Prior to or during the meeting we will go through your photography contract to make sure you don't have any questions, and all elements are agreed upon. This way we both know exactly what to expect. I am transparent with my clients, so if you have any questions I want to make sure they are answered! Upon signing the contract, the retainer is also due. This secures your chosen date. In the upcoming days/ months to your chosen date we discuss details such as outfits, and locations.

- What advice would you give a customer looking to hire a provider in your area of work?
Find someone that fits your style, just as much as they fit your price. Photos are the one thing that will carry memories outside of your mind throughout the years. I can't even explain how meaningful it is to have the chance to share the most special, and current moments in our lives with future generations! Especially when it comes to your wedding day, it can be a blur of happy moments. Having someone there to photograph and document those moments will let you relive that happiness over and over again forever.
